Penelitian menganalisa persebaran indeks kerawanan DBD berdasarkan incidence rate (IR). Penelitian ini dilaksanakan di Kabupaten Bombana Provinsi Sulawesi Tenggara Penelitian menggunakan desain kuantitatif. Objek analisis adalah jumlah kasus, frekuensi serta indeks kerawan. Data dianalisis secara deksriptif kualitaif dan analisis spasial (ArcView 3.2). Kasus DBD di Kabupaten Bombana tersebar di enam kecamatan dan 35 desa/kelurahan. Poleang Barat 208 kasus, Poleang 111 kasus, Poleang Selatan 64 kasus, Poleang Timur 46 kasus, Rumbia 24 kasus dan Rumbia Tengah 17 kasus. Ada 12 desa/kelurahan berstatus “sangat rawan”, 6 yang “rawan”, 2 yang “agak rawan”, 8 yang “agak aman” dan 7 desa/kelurahan yang “aman”. Rata-rata jumlah kasus DBD yang terjadi sekitar 0,33-0,98 % dari total jumlah penduduk. Ditemukan usia 0-10 tahun (48,30 %), 11-20 tahun (28,09 %). Menjangkiti laki-laki sebanyak 49,57 % dan perempuan 50,43 %.
